Output 95a89c101bcf90d620dc40d60d9c86096db7a4c91c5e4fec98f6820a0320c84e:25

value
1416647
script pubkey
OP_0 OP_PUSHBYTES_20 4ce6d0bec6c750d884d37e3bc00f2a3eca54a670
address
ltc1qfnndp0kxcagd3pxn0cauqre28m99ffnsvjuz95
transaction
95a89c101bcf90d620dc40d60d9c86096db7a4c91c5e4fec98f6820a0320c84e
spent
true